Recent meteorological forecasts from the Pakistan Meteorological Department and global models indicate partly cloudy conditions with southwest sea breezes and residual monsoon moisture will likely cap Karachi’s September 18 high near 33–34°C. Light rain and thunderstorms over the prior 48 hours have increased cloud cover and humidity, moderating daytime heating compared with earlier September peaks above 37°C. Key variables differentiating the closely matched 31–36°C outcomes include afternoon wind speeds, exact cloud fraction, and dew-point suppression of surface temperatures. Updated model runs and the official PMD briefing expected on September 17 will provide the next resolution-relevant data as traders weigh these atmospheric factors.

The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the highest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=opkc
If NOAA data for the observation date is unavailable by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, the Weather Underground Daily Observations table will be used as the resolution source.
In the event that there is no data for the observation date by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, this market will resolve to the lowest bracket.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to Metric Units" button until the relevant table displays °C.
This market will resolve once the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source, or by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, whichever comes first.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
